Niceol Blue is a storyteller in song and spoken word. A singer, songwriter, writer, improviser and storyteller, she grew up in the Pacific Northwest of the US; an environment that helped to shape all of her artforms. Niceol is a published musician, poet and writer, with award-winning work that has been described as ‘exceptionally moving’. Now at home in Galway, Ireland, Niceol is a founding member of The Moth and Butterfly Storytelling Collective, and can often be found singing songs and telling stories to audiences worldwide.
